Career Paths

  1. Retail Manager: Retail managers oversee the day-to-day operations of stores or retail chains, focusing on sales, customer service, and store management.

  2. Merchandising Manager: Merchandising managers are responsible for planning and executing product assortments, displays, and inventory strategies to maximize sales.

  3. Marketing Manager: Marketing managers develop and implement marketing strategies to promote retail products and attract customers.

  4. E-commerce Manager: E-commerce managers focus on managing online retail operations, including website management, digital marketing, and online customer experience.

  5. Supply Chain Manager: Supply chain managers optimize the flow of products from suppliers to stores, ensuring efficient inventory management and timely deliveries.

  6. Store Designer and Visual Merchandiser: Store designers and visual merchandisers create visually appealing store layouts and displays to enhance the shopping experience.

  7. Retail Analyst: Retail analysts analyze sales data, market trends, and consumer behaviour to provide insights for decision-making.

Job Opportunities

  1. Retail Chains: National and international retail chains offer a wide range of roles in store management, merchandising, and marketing.

  2. E-commerce Companies: Online retailers seek professionals to manage e-commerce platforms, digital marketing, and customer experience.

  3. Fashion Retail: The fashion industry offers opportunities in fashion retail management, visual merchandising, and brand management.

  4. Grocery Retail: Grocery store chains hire retail managers, category managers, and supply chain professionals to ensure smooth operations.

  5. Consumer Electronics Retail: Electronics retailers seek professionals to manage store operations and marketing of electronic products.

  6. Luxury Retail: Luxury brands require professionals with expertise in luxury retail management and brand promotion.

  7. Retail Consulting: Consulting firms specializing in retail management hire experts to provide strategic guidance to retail clients.
